BrowserAct

BrowserAct

WebsiteFree TrialAI Web Scraper
BrowserAct est un runtime d'automatisation de navigateur natif pour agents (CLI, workflows, API/MCP) qui exécute des sessions Chrome réelles/furtives avec isolation de session, anti-blocage intégré (rotation d'empreinte/TLS, proxys résidentiels), gestion automatique des CAPTCHA et sortie de données web structurées propres pour le raisonnement LLM.
https://www.browseract.com/?ref=producthunt&utm_source=aipure
BrowserAct

Informations sur le produit

Mis à jour:Jun 29, 2026

Qu'est-ce que BrowserAct

BrowserAct est une plateforme d'automatisation web et d'extraction de données basée sur l'IA, conçue pour donner aux agents IA un accès fiable aux sites web réels. Au lieu d'écrire et de maintenir des scrapers fragiles, les utilisateurs peuvent piloter un navigateur via une "compétence" CLI, un canevas de workflow sans/peu de code, ou des intégrations programmatiques (API/MCP) pour naviguer dans les pages, cliquer, taper, extraire des données et exporter les résultats sous forme de sorties structurées propres (par exemple, des tableaux/lignes prêtes pour le CSV). Il est positionné comme une "couche de navigateur" pour les agents – conçue pour gérer les contraintes de navigation du monde réel comme les connexions, les pages dynamiques, la protection contre les bots et la concurrence multi-session tout en gardant les sorties faciles à consommer pour les LLM.

Caractéristiques principales de BrowserAct

BrowserAct est un environnement d'exécution d'automatisation de navigateur natif pour agents (plus CLI, workflows et intégrations API/MCP) qui permet aux agents IA de naviguer de manière fiable sur de vrais sites web, de contourner les blocages anti-bot courants, de résoudre les CAPTCHA, de réutiliser les sessions Chrome authentifiées et de renvoyer des données web propres et structurées pour un raisonnement et une automatisation en aval. Il met l'accent sur l'isolation furtive de l'identité/de l'empreinte digitale, la concurrence multi-session et le contrôle de sécurité pour les actions sensibles, permettant à la fois des workflows sans code/visuels et des intégrations de développeurs dans des piles comme Make, n8n et Zapier.
Navigation furtive + couches anti-blocage: Utilise des empreintes digitales furtives, la rotation TLS et (éventuellement) des proxys résidentiels pour réduire la détection des bots et faire en sorte que les sessions ressemblent à de vrais utilisateurs, aidant les agents à accéder aux pages bloquées ou protégées.
Gestion intégrée des CAPTCHA et des vérifications: Gère automatiquement les défis populaires (par exemple, reCAPTCHA, Cloudflare Turnstile, DataDome, HUMAN Security) avec une assistance humaine en dernier recours pour les blocages difficiles comme la 2FA.
Sortie structurée native pour agents (données web propres): Renvoie une structure de page utile sous forme de données indexées à faible bruit (au lieu du DOM brut) afin que les LLM puissent raisonner et extraire de manière fiable avec moins de jetons et moins de fragilité.
Actions de navigateur commandables pour les agents: Permet des cibles d'action stables pour les flux de clic/saisie/attente/téléchargement/navigation, prenant en charge l'automatisation et le scraping reproductibles sans écrire de code de scraper traditionnel.
Isolation de session + identités multi-comptes: Exécute plusieurs sessions de navigateur indépendantes en parallèle sans pollution d'état ; prend en charge la rotation des identités pour le scraping en masse et les identités fixes (cookies, empreinte digitale, proxy statique) pour les opérations multi-comptes.
Plusieurs façons de fonctionner : CLI/Skills, Workflows, API/MCP: Utilisez localement avec des compétences d'agent (Claude Code/Cursor/Codex, etc.), créez des workflows cloud visuels ou intégrez via API/MCP dans des produits et des automatisations (Make, n8n, Zapier).

Cas d'utilisation de BrowserAct

Surveillance concurrentielle du commerce électronique: Récupérer en continu les pages produits des concurrents pour le prix, la disponibilité et les avis (même derrière les contrôles anti-bot) et alimenter les systèmes de tarification/stock avec des données structurées.
Enrichissement de la génération de ventes et de prospects: Automatiser la collecte de données de prospects ou d'entreprises à partir de sites web et d'annuaires, puis pousser les enregistrements propres dans les CRM ou les outils de prospection via API ou des intégrations sans code.
Recrutement / veille du marché de l'emploi: Extraire en masse les offres d'emploi et les champs structurés (titre, lieu, salaire, exigences) des sites d'emploi et les livrer dans les pipelines ATS ou les tableaux de bord d'analyse.
Étude de marché à partir des actualités et des communautés: Recueillir les nouvelles de l'industrie, les mises à jour des concurrents et les signaux de sentiment à partir de sources comme les sites d'actualités et les forums, produisant des résultats structurés pour l'analyse et le reporting.
Automatisation de tableau de bord authentifié: Réutiliser l'état de connexion Chrome local pour opérer à l'intérieur d'applications web connectées (SSO, cookies, extensions) afin d'exporter des rapports, de télécharger des CSV ou d'effectuer des tâches de back-office répétitives.
Automatisation des workflows dans les piles d'opérations: Déclencher des tâches de navigateur à partir de workflows Make/n8n/Zapier (par exemple, vérifier un portail, extraire un tableau, soumettre un formulaire) et renvoyer des données web vérifiées aux étapes en aval.

Avantages

Haute fiabilité sur les sites réels grâce à la furtivité, à la gestion des vérifications et à l'interaction auto-réparatrice/pilotée par agent (moins de maintenance de sélecteur).
Sortie conviviale pour les agents (données propres et indexées) améliore la précision et réduit le gaspillage de jetons par rapport au scraping DOM brut.
Prend en charge les sessions parallèles et isolées et les scénarios multi-comptes sans contamination croisée.
Chemins d'adoption flexibles : CLI/compétences locales, workflows visuels et intégrations API/MCP avec les plateformes d'automatisation courantes.

Inconvénients

Certaines fonctionnalités avancées sont payantes (notamment les proxys gérés et les navigateurs furtifs au-delà d'une allocation gratuite initiale).
Les flux bloquants comme la 2FA peuvent encore nécessiter une intervention humaine, limitant l'autonomie complète de bout en bout pour certains sites.
En tant que produit plus récent, il peut présenter des lacunes occasionnelles en matière de modèles/fonctionnalités et une UX évolutive par rapport aux écosystèmes d'automatisation matures.

Comment utiliser BrowserAct

1) Choisissez comment vous utiliserez BrowserAct: Choisissez le bon point d'entrée pour votre besoin : (a) Local + Agent via l'Agent CLI (pilotez un navigateur réel/furtif depuis votre machine locale), (b) Workflow Cloud (construisez un workflow visuel/en langage naturel qui exécute des étapes de navigateur), ou (c) API/MCP (intégrez BrowserAct dans votre produit ou pile d'automatisation comme Make/n8n/Zapier).
2) Installez l'Agent CLI de BrowserAct (utilisation locale): Installez l'Agent CLI de BrowserAct sur votre machine locale afin que votre agent (Claude Code/Cursor/Codex/Windsurf/etc.) puisse exécuter des actions de navigateur. La commande d'installation officielle affichée dans les documents/extraits est : `uv tool install browser-act-cli --python 3.12`.
3) Installez la compétence browser-act dans votre environnement d'agent: Ajoutez la définition de la compétence BrowserAct (souvent appelée installation de la compétence `browser-act`) afin que votre agent connaisse les commandes disponibles et le workflow d'interaction. Cela permet à l'agent d'émettre des commandes browser-act et de recevoir une sortie web propre et indexée pour le raisonnement.
4) Décidez quel mode de navigateur convient à votre scénario: Utilisez l'un des modes documentés : (a) Réutiliser l'état de connexion Chrome local pour les sites authentifiés (cookies/SSO/extensions/sessions fiables), (b) Mode privé furtif pour le scraping en masse (nouvelle identité par tâche), ou (c) Mode furtif à identité fixe pour le travail multi-comptes (empreinte stable + cookies + espace de travail + proxy résidentiel statique).
5) Lancez une session de navigateur en tenant compte de l'isolation: Démarrez une session de navigateur BrowserAct adaptée à votre mode. BrowserAct isole les identités et les espaces de travail afin que vous puissiez exécuter plusieurs sessions en parallèle sans mélange de comptes ni pollution d'état.
6) Naviguez vers l'URL cible: Utilisez la CLI/compétence pour ouvrir la page avec laquelle vous souhaitez travailler (y compris les pages riches en JavaScript). Exemple du flux de démonstration officiel : visitez une page comme `https://www.amazon.com/gp/bestsellers/electronics`.
7) Laissez BrowserAct gérer les blocages et la vérification: Si le site déclenche des vérifications anti-bot, la couche d'environnement de BrowserAct (empreintes furtives, rotation TLS, proxys résidentiels) vise à prévenir les blocages ; si un défi apparaît, la couche d'exécution peut résoudre automatiquement les CAPTCHA (reCAPTCHA, Cloudflare Turnstile, DataDome, HUMAN Security, etc.).
8) Utilisez le transfert humain pour les arrêts difficiles (par exemple, 2FA): Lorsque l'automatisation ne peut pas se poursuivre (généralement 2FA), utilisez l'assistance à distance de BrowserAct pour générer un lien de prise de contrôle en direct pour mobile/ordinateur, laissez un humain terminer l'étape, puis redonnez le contrôle à l'agent.
9) Interagissez avec la page (cliquer/taper/soumettre/attendre/télécharger): Pilotez le navigateur comme un véritable utilisateur : cliquez sur les boutons, tapez dans les champs de saisie, soumettez les formulaires, attendez les changements d'état de la page et téléchargez des fichiers si nécessaire. BrowserAct renvoie des cibles d'action stables et indexées plutôt que le DOM brut pour réduire la fragilité des sélecteurs.
10) Extrayez des données propres et structurées (pas le DOM brut): Demandez l'extraction de la structure utile de la page sous forme de sortie propre et à faible jeton, adaptée au raisonnement (par exemple, listes/lignes/champs). Dans la démo officielle, l'agent extrait le classement/produit/prix/avis/ASIN des meilleures ventes d'Amazon.
11) Exportez les résultats vers un fichier (par exemple, CSV) si nécessaire: Demandez à BrowserAct d'exporter les données extraites dans un artefact utilisable (CSV est montré dans la démo). Résultat exemple : `Exported → ./bestsellers.csv` contenant des lignes structurées.
12) Évoluez en toute sécurité avec la concurrence: Exécutez plusieurs agents/tâches en parallèle. Pour le scraping en masse, utilisez des identités tournantes ; pour le multi-comptes, liez chaque compte à une identité fixe (empreinte + cookies + proxy résidentiel statique + espace de travail) pour éviter la contamination entre les comptes.
13) Utilisez la porte de confirmation pour les opérations sensibles: Soyez prêt à approuver explicitement les actions sensibles (création/suppression de navigateur, importation de profil, changements de proxy, bascules de sécurité/confidentialité et étapes humaines). BrowserAct applique cette porte de confirmation au niveau de la couche de compétence ; les approbations ne sont pas reportées.
14) (Facultatif) Créez une compétence réutilisable avec Skill Forge: Si vous avez besoin d'extractions/actions répétables sur un site spécifique (surtout à grande échelle), décrivez ce que vous voulez en langage clair et générez une compétence personnalisée via Skill Forge (sans codage). Réutilisez ensuite cette compétence pour des exécutions fiables et répétables.
15) (Facultatif) Utilisez les workflows cloud pour l'automatisation visuelle: Créez un workflow qui séquence des étapes comme Visiter l'URL → Cliquer sur le bouton → Extraire les données. Ceci est utile pour l'automatisation sans code et les exécutions de scraping répétables gérées comme des workflows.
16) (Facultatif) Intégrez via API/MCP dans votre pile: Pour l'intégration de produits ou l'automatisation orchestrée, appelez BrowserAct via API ou MCP, ou connectez-le à des outils comme Make/n8n/Zapier pour déclencher des tâches de navigateur et renvoyer des données web structurées à vos systèmes.

FAQ de BrowserAct

BrowserAct est un runtime de navigateur natif pour l'automatisation web et l'extraction de données. Il permet aux agents IA d'exécuter de véritables tâches de navigateur (naviguer, cliquer, taper, extraire) et renvoie des données web propres et structurées pour le raisonnement.

Derniers outils d'IA similaires à BrowserAct

Jorpex
Jorpex
Jorpex est une plateforme complète de notification d'appel d'offres qui agrège et livre des alertes d'appel d'offres instantanées provenant de pays européens directement à Slack, aidant les entreprises à ne jamais manquer d'opportunités.
Leadsmrt
Leadsmrt
Leadsmrt est un outil de génération de leads qui aide les entreprises à scraper, vérifier et personnaliser des leads commerciaux ciblés à partir de Google Maps avec des capacités de personnalisation alimentées par l'IA.
Omnial AI
Omnial AI
Omnial AI est une plateforme d'intelligence des données qui exploite des agents IA pour transformer des invites web en informations de données structurées et exploitables soutenues par Afore Capital.
SERPrecon
SERPrecon
SERPrecon est un outil SEO avancé qui exploite les vecteurs, l'apprentissage automatique et le traitement du langage naturel pour aider les utilisateurs à analyser et à surpasser leurs concurrents en utilisant les mêmes méthodes que les moteurs de recherche modernes.